Also, you might suspect the SW local oscillator transistor, which is a
little round plastic disc with four leads coming out at right angles, every
90 degrees. I have fixed a couple of RF5000's where they were intermittent,
and when I removed the local osc transistor after deciding it was a problem,
it just fell apart.

Whatever you do, don't take that bandswitch apart!

I have a Panasonic RF5000 and all the SW bands are dead. They only get
images from local FM stations. BUT........ yesterday when it was left on

all
day on SW, when I returned home, the SW was working! Today, its been on an
hour, still nothing on SW bands. Touched all the parts with my hand, on

the
inside, to see if it was something loose, and it's not that. Maybe a

common
oscillator cap that goes bad? Appreciate any fixes. Please Post reply to
